Concrete Deck Sealing in Seattle, WA
Concrete deck sealing services help protect outdoor surfaces such as patios, walkways, porches, and pool decks from damage caused by moisture, stains, and weathering. This process involves applying a protective sealant to the surface of the concrete to create a barrier that prevents water penetration, reduces the risk of cracking, and maintains the deck’s appearance over time. Property owners often request this service to extend the lifespan of their outdoor concrete and keep it looking clean and well-maintained, especially in areas exposed to frequent rain or heavy foot traffic.
Before requesting concrete deck sealing, property owners typically want to understand the current condition of their concrete surface, including whether it requires cleaning or repairs prior to sealing. It’s also helpful to know the type of sealant used and how often resealing might be needed to preserve the surface’s integrity. Proper surface preparation and choosing the right sealant can ensure the best results, making this service a valuable step in preserving outdoor concrete features for years to come.

Concrete Deck Sealing Questions
What is concrete deck sealing? Concrete deck sealing involves applying a protective coating to surfaces like patios or balconies to prevent water penetration and damage.
Why should property owners consider sealing their concrete decks?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of the deck, reduces cracking, and maintains appearance by protecting against moisture and stains.
What types of decks benefit most from sealing? Concrete decks exposed to weather elements, such as those in outdoor living areas, are ideal candidates for sealing.
How often should a concrete deck be resealed? Typically, resealing every 2 to 3 years helps maintain optimal protection and appearance.
